Bug Description

Hello,

I am using MAAS 2.7.0 (8232-g.6e1dba4ab-0ubuntu1~18.04.1) and I found that inside a machine's network tab there is a bug with bond related interfaces.

Being more specific, if interface_a and interface_b form a bond_a then the GUI shows:

bond_a: interface_a_mac
 - interface_a: interface_a_mac
 - interface_b: interface_a_mac

The correct one should be:

bond_a: interface_a_mac
 - interface_a: interface_a_mac
 - interface_b: interface_b_mac
